Expandable microspheres, such as the ADVANCELL WS606 mentioned in industry literature, are hollow thermoplastic spheres that expand when heated. These physical foaming agents are typically activated at temperatures ranging from 140-150°C and can reach up to 180-190°C for maximum expansion. Their primary application is in gas injection foaming processes for materials like TPR, PVC, and EVA, as well as general plastics and rubber foaming. The benefit of using expandable microspheres lies in their ability to create very fine cell structures and contribute to lightweighting without the chemical byproducts associated with certain blowing agents.
The interplay between chemical and physical foaming agents is a growing area of interest. For instance, while Azodicarbonamide is a high-temperature foaming agent for plastics and rubber, expandable microspheres can be used in conjunction to achieve enhanced foam properties or to process polymers that have different temperature requirements. This dual approach allows manufacturers to optimize material performance and cost-effectiveness.
